Agent Description

There is living, and then there is lifestyle. Tick them both off – and more - in a slick 4-bedroom renovation that goes the extra rural mile with extensive all-seasons entertaining, electric double carport gates, and the most serene reserve outlooks. And now's the time to witness its blaze of autumn glory from your landscaped 1002sqm stage. Inside and out, the Millenium-built home - even better today thanks to the addition of the all-weather 84sqm deck and two redesigned bathrooms – gleans every possible nature-blessed perspective. The floorplan flows effortlessly from the north-facing, bay window lounge room to casual dining, and the rear family room with glass sliders that float outdoors to the alfresco; and if you're not treating a crowd, take a stool at the high bar where the return verandah follows the reserve. Prepping like a dream, the kitchen hosts a Miele dishwasher, 5-burner Westinghouse gas cooktop, electric oven, and underlines its newfound chic with upgraded benchtops, matte black sinks, and a dramatic subway tile splashback. All four retreating bedrooms enjoy ceiling fans, built-in robes, and a soft plantation shuttered glow; the master drawn through a corridor of walk-in robes to a monochromatic ensuite; the 3-way family bathroom deserving another tick for chic monochromatic style continuity. If this doesn't spell light-filled modern country living, we don't know what does. Undergoing a roof upgrade, a 10kW solar installation (with a generator switch for backup power), and ramped deck access via the high-clearance carport – with ample space to tuck the caravan or trailer away - it's a home that works magic for any demographic. The shaded tree swing and play space keeps the kids amused, yet we know you'll be calling them in for dinner from the creek bed and grassed infinity across the back fence… Ahead of you, everything else is in hollering distance. The butcher, baker, boutique distilleries, schooling, and the scenic OVR gateway to a string of cellar doors; Balhannah's forte. Parked in Sunningdale Court's most picturesque corner, you'll live like no one else exists. What a way to honour the hills. You're going to love calling it home: Timber-framed c2000-built family home on a 1002sqm landscaped parcel. Set on a quiet street bend with a serene reserve backdrop. Decking, new bathrooms & laundry all redone 3 years ago. Roof restoration 2 years ago Superb outdoor entertaining with café blinds, bar & views 6m x 6m double carport secured by electric gates. Family room combustion fire Split system R/C A/C Master with designer ensuite & WIR Plantation shutters, fans & BIRs to all bedrooms Modern, monochromatic 3-way family bathroom 15sqm concrete-floored shed + garden shed + woodshed Mains water & sewer Mains power with 10kW solar & generator switch for backup electricity Manual pop-up irrigation *All measurements approx.
